什么是MPM? MPM(Multi -Processing Modules,多路处理模块)是Apache2.x中影响性能的最核心特性。是Apache 2.x才支持
转载 2022-10-20 09:30:07
99阅读
什么是MPM?  MPM(Multi -Processing Modules,多路处理模块)是Apache2.x中影响性能的最核心特性。 是Apache 2.x才支持的一个可插入的并发模型,在编译的时候,我们只可以选择一个并发模型。  配置文件:/usr/local/apache2/conf/extra/httpd-mpm.conf  如果a
转载 2011-08-23 13:05:45
1982阅读
介绍Apache HTTP 服务器被设计为一个功能强大,并且灵活的 web 服务器,可以在很多平台与环境中工作。不同平台和不同的环境往往需要不同的特性,或可能以不同的方式实现相同的特性最有效率。Apache httpd通过模块化的设计来适应各种环境。这种设计允许网站管理员通过在编译时或运行时,选择哪些模块将会加载在服务器中,来选择服务器特性。Apache HTTP 服务器 2.0 扩展此模块化设计
原创 2014-06-30 19:59:58
1559阅读
1点赞
1评论
Apache的核心特征和多处理模块:core:一直可用的apache http服务器的核心功能mpm_common:有一个以上的MPM实现的指令的集合beos:为BEOS特别优化的MPMevent:基本的worker MPM的实验变种mpm_netware:MPM专门为Novell NetWare实施优化的一个线程web服务器优化mpmt_os2:专门为OS/2混合多进程、多线程的MPMprefo
转载 精选 2014-02-16 16:15:21
691阅读
Apache使用哪种MPM在在安装的时候可以用 --with-mpm={beos|worker|prefork|mpmt_os2|perchild|leader|threadpool} 安装之后可以用httpd -l命令看到。 MPM的进程模块有有很多种( 见Apache官方文档:http://httpd.apache.org/docs-2.0/mod/)。 今天我主要是比较
转载 精选 2010-10-19 13:25:47
836阅读
apache在prefork和worker之间切换:[root@Wiker ~]# vim/etc/httpd/conf/httpd.conf<IfModuleprefork.c>StartServers       8MinSpareServers    5MaxSpareServers   20ServerLimit &n
原创 2014-02-16 19:54:14
2079阅读
 一、MPM模块简介  多路处理模块,Multi-Processing Modules,MPM。负责绑定本机网络端口、接受请求,并调度子进程来处理请求。   二、MPM模块的类型 prefork 一个非线程型的、预派生的MPM worker 线程型的MPM,实现了一个混合的多线程多处理MPM,允许一个子进程中包含多个线程。 event 
原创 2013-02-21 11:09:18
776阅读
1点赞
1、什么是MPM? Multi-Processing Module (MPM) implements a hybrid multi-process multi-threaded server。(多进程、多线程)2、有多少种MPM? 大致有:prefork MPM、worker MPM、BeOS MPM、NetWare MPM、OS/2 MPM、WinNT MPM。  &nbsp
原创 2016-09-20 23:11:57
545阅读
MPM优化你的Apache 作者:squall E-mail:squall@grlinux.net 前言:  最近朋友的服务器访问量过大,导致页面打开迟缓,下载速度也降到了30-40KB/秒,由于经费和环境问题,集群方案没有得以应用。考虑了如上的因素,我决定通过对Apache增加模块来进行优化,下面是我的实施过程,如果你对其感兴趣,不妨一看。 正文: Apache 2.0在性
转载 精选 2009-05-14 11:17:33
329阅读
             apache配置mpm_worker(多道处理模块)worker的工作原理及配置worker是2.0 版中全新的支持多线程和多进程混合模型的MPM。由于使用线程来处理,所以可以处理相对海量的请求,而系统资源的开销要小于基于进程的服务器,worker也使用
转载 精选 2010-08-04 16:58:47
673阅读
  查看aoache在哪个模式下运行:[root@www ~]# /usr/local/apache2/bin/apachectl -lapache三种工作模式:prefork worker event如何使用apache的 work模式还是 prefork 模式注意: 2.4之前版本默认为prefork, 2.4已经变为event模式在编译apache的时候,有一个参数叫做 
原创 2015-07-25 20:21:13
574阅读
prefork(子进程)-内存占用大    2.2版本默认    worker(线程)-内存占用小      适用访问量大的时候            event  --worker的升级版     2.4版本
原创 2016-06-08 15:42:09
355阅读
查看Apache工作模式的命令是:[root@qiangzi httpd-2.2.32]# /usr/local/apache2/bin/apachectl -M[root@qiangzi ~]# /usr/local/apache2/bin/apachectl -MLoaded Modules:core_module (static)authn_file_module (static)authn
原创 2017-06-14 17:10:19
565阅读
简介 Apache HTTP服务器被设计为一个强大的、灵活的能够在多种平台以及不同环境下工作的服务器。不同的平台和不同的环境经常产生不同的需求,或是为了达到同样的最佳效果而采用不同的方法。Apache凭借它的模块化设计很好的适应了大量不同的环境。这一设计使得网站管理员能够在编译时和运行时凭借载入不同的模块来决定服务器的不同附加功能。   Apache2.0将这种模块化的设计延伸
转载 2008-09-17 10:33:20
540阅读
简介 Apache HTTP服务器被设计为一个强大的、灵活的能够在多种平台以及不同环境下工作的服务器。不同的平台和不同的环境经常产生不同的需求,或是为了达到同样的最佳效果而采用不同的方法。Apache凭借它的模块化设计很好的适应了大量不同的环境。这一设计使得网站管理员能够在编译时和运行时凭借载入不同的模块来决定服务器的不同附加功能。   Apache2.0将这种模块化的设计延伸到了
转载 精选 2008-04-08 15:08:31
1178阅读
MPM优化你的Apache[学习笔记] 作者:squall E-mail:squall@grlinux.net 前言: 最近朋友的服务器访问量过大,导致页面打开迟缓,下载速度也降到了30-40KB/秒,由于经费和环境问题,集群方案没有得以应用。考虑了如上的因素,我决定通过对Apache增加模块来进行优化,下面是我的实施过程,如果你对其感兴趣,不妨一看。 正文: Apac
转载 精选 2011-12-13 00:52:58
418阅读
MPM(多路处理模块),apache处理处理并发的三种方式 1、perfork:预处理模式 2、worker:工作模式 3、winnt:这个一般说是windows下采用的,也是一种worker模式。
原创 2013-09-04 22:51:36
660阅读
1点赞
apache的几种工作模式event、worker、prefork
原创 2020-10-06 21:39:07
686阅读
系统下如果优化Apache的性能。 执行"httpd -l"就看到windows+apa
转载 2022-12-02 10:38:32
266阅读
Author:小怪兽Nikki 微博:@再见了小怪兽去除http.conf中Include conf/extra/httpd-mpm.conf前的#,以使httpd-mpm.conf中的配置生效。 #Server-pool management (MPM specific) Include conf/extra/httpd-mpm.conf 一、Apache的默认情况 &l
原创 2014-11-07 17:31:54
736阅读
  • 1
  • 2
  • 3
  • 4
  • 5